WebA mortgage is high-ratio when your down payment is less than 20% of the property value. Close. Mortgage principal is the amount of money you borrow from a lender. If a mortgage is for $250,000, then the mortgage principal is $250,000. You pay the principal, with interest, back to the lender over time through mortgage payments. WebA Fixed-rate mortgage is a home loan with a fixed interest rate for the entire term of the loan. The Loan term is the period of time during which a loan must be repaid. For example, a 30-year fixed-rate loan has a term of 30 years. An Adjustable-rate mortgage (ARM) is a mortgage in which your interest rate and monthly payments may change periodically … WebBecause of this, many consumers find fixed-rate mortgage options more attractive.
